TECO东元电机-东元变频器-teco东元电机股份有限公司官网

產品分類

當前位置: 首頁 > 工業電氣產品 > 端子與連接器 > 線路板連接器

類型分類:
科普知識
數據分類:
線路板連接器

西門子S7-1200間接尋址指令的應用

發布日期:2022-04-17 點擊率:168 品牌:西門子_Siemens

   西門子S7-1200的間接尋址需要通過數據塊中的數組來實現。指令FieldRead通過索引(又稱為下標)變量從數組中讀取數值,指令FieldWrite 通過索引變量向數組中寫數值,使用這兩條指令可以實現間接尋址。

    索引變量是間接尋址中的地址指針,它的值是要讀寫的數組元素的索引值。地址指針就像收音機調臺的指針,改變指針的位置,指針指向不同電臺。改變地址指針中的索引值,指針“指向”數組不同的元素。間接尋址的優點是可以在程序處理期間,通過改變指針的值動態地修改指令中的地址。

    首先生成一個名為“數據塊1”的全局數據塊DB2,在數據塊中生成名為“數組1”的數組Array[1..10] of Int,其元素的數據類型為Int。

    這兩條指令沒有列入指令列表和高級指令列表,編程時將收藏夾中的空邏輯框插入程序,點擊其中紅色的“??”,打開下拉式列表框,可以看到列表框底部的指令FieldWrite或FieldRead。點擊生成的指令框中的“???”,用列表設置要寫入或讀取的數據類型為Int(見下圖)。兩條指令的參數MEMBER的實參必須是數組的第一個元素“數據塊1”.數組1[1]。

    指令的輸入參數索引值“INDEX”是要讀寫的數組中的元素的下標,數據類型為DINT(雙整數)。參數“VALUE”是要寫入數組元素的值或要讀取的數組元素的值。

    下圖中的FieldWrite指令將常數25寫入數組1中的元素“數組1[3]”。FieldRead指令讀取數組元素“數組1[3]”的值,將它保存到MW20。改變INDEX的值,可以讀寫別的數組元素的值。

下一篇: PLC、DCS、FCS三大控

上一篇: 索爾維全系列Solef?PV

推薦產品

更多
主站蜘蛛池模板: 亚洲 欧美 清纯 校园 另类 | 欧美日韩亚洲视频 | 亚洲色图激情小说 | 日夜操在线视频 | 久久久久免费看成人影片 | 国产精品高清网站 | 亚洲yy | 欧美人在线观看免费视频 | 久久久精品久久日韩一区综合 | 日韩一区二区三区在线免费观看 | 免费视频福利 | 国产成人精品福利网站在线观看 | 亚洲国产精品毛片av不卡在线 | 四虎影院免费 | 日韩精品无码人成视频手机 | 婷婷综合另类小说色区 | 国产免费美女 | 天堂在线www天堂在线 | 欧美成视频无需播放器 | 免费一级特黄欧美大片久久网 | 熟妇人妻中文字幕 | 无限资源欧美 | 日本免费三区 | 午夜禁18男欢女爱视频 | 国产精品无码素人福利 | 久久99亚洲精品久久久久99 | 日本人六九视频69jzz免费 | 成人激情综合 | 国产精品污www一区二区三区 | 伊人久久大香线蕉综合影院首页 | 波多野结衣绝顶大高潮 | 国产欧美在线一区二区三区 | 久久99国产精品久久99 | 欧美成人中文字幕 | 久久理论片午夜琪琪电影网 | 日日拍夜夜嗷嗷叫视频 | 国产午夜在线观看 | 爱爱免费小视频 | 99在线精品免费视频九九视 | 国产精品成在线观看 | 99久久久久国产精品免费 |